My Buying Guides on Remote Control Car Battery Charger

1. Why I Pay Attention to Charger Compatibility

When I shop for a remote control car battery charger, the first thing I check is whether it matches my battery type. Not every charger works with every battery, so I always look for compatibility with LiPo, NiMH, NiCd, or Li-ion batteries, depending on what my RC car uses. I also make sure the charger supports the correct voltage and cell count. This helps me avoid damage to my battery and keeps charging safe.

2. How I Check Charging Speed

I like chargers that save me time, but I never choose speed over safety. I look at the charger’s output current, usually measured in amps, to understand how fast it can charge my battery. A higher amp rating can mean quicker charging, but I still prefer a charger that lets me adjust the charging rate. That way, I can protect battery life while still getting a decent charge time.

3. Why Safety Features Matter to Me

Safety is a big deal in my buying decision. I always look for features like overcharge protection, short-circuit protection, reverse polarity protection, and temperature monitoring. If I use LiPo batteries, I also want balance charging and storage mode. These features give me peace of mind and help me avoid battery damage or accidents.

4. My Preference for Balance Charging

If I use LiPo batteries, I never skip balance charging. I find that a charger with balance ports keeps each cell at the same voltage, which helps my battery perform better and last longer. For me, this is one of the most important features because it improves both safety and battery health.

6. How I Decide Between AC and DC Chargers

I think about where I’ll be using the charger. If I want something convenient for home use, I usually look for an AC charger that plugs directly into the wall. If I want more flexibility, especially for field charging, I consider a DC charger that can connect to a power supply or car battery. Sometimes I choose a charger that supports both, which gives me the most versatility.
